Smart Weather Condition Sensors
Smart weather sensing units have actually changed the performance of modern-day irrigation systems by readjusting sprinkling routines based upon real-time environmental data. These sensing units keep track of variables such as temperature level, humidity, wind speed, and solar radiation, allowing systems to react dynamically to transforming climate condition. By integrating this data, smart sensors can optimize water use, lowering waste and ensuring that landscapes receive the ideal amount of moisture. This technology not just saves water yet additionally promotes much healthier plant development by avoiding overwatering or underwatering. Additionally, the automation provided by wise weather sensors enhances customer ease, as landscaping companies and property owners can count on accurate watering timetables without hands-on treatment. Generally, these technologies represent a substantial improvement in lasting watering techniques.

Dirt Moisture Sensors
Soil wetness sensors play an important duty in modern-day watering systems, providing real-time data that improves water effectiveness. These gadgets determine the volumetric water web content in the soil, enabling precise analyses of moisture degrees. By integrating dirt wetness sensors into irrigation systems, users can avoid overwatering or underwatering, inevitably promoting much healthier plant growth and preserving water resources.The sensing units transmit data to controllers, which can adjust sprinkling timetables based upon present soil problems. This data-driven method minimizes water waste and assurances that plants receive the ideal amount of wetness. Furthermore, soil moisture sensors can be helpful in different agricultural setups, from home gardens to large-scale ranches. The release of these sensing units adds to sustainable methods by sustaining accountable water usage and lowering ecological effect. On the whole, the unification of dirt wetness sensors marks a considerable advancement in attaining reliable irrigation systems.
